1. Standard Disc Locks

The U-Haul standard disc lock is one of the most popular locks for securing moving trucks and trailers. It comes in a 2-inch size and is made of hardened steel, which makes it very difficult to break. The lock is also resistant to drilling and picking, ensuring that your belongings stay secure throughout your moving journey.

2. Cylinder Locks

If you’re looking for a more heavy-duty lock, then U-Haul’s cylinder lock is a great choice. It comes in a 3-inch size and is made of solid steel, which makes it virtually indestructible. This lock is ideal for high-security applications, such as storage units or trailers that carry valuable items.

Factors to Consider for U-Haul Lock Size

An appropriate lock size is necessary when renting a U-Haul moving truck or trailer. The right lock size ensures that your belongings in transit are protected against theft and damage. However, choosing the appropriate lock size can be challenging, especially for first-time renters. Here are several factors to consider when determining the right U-Haul lock size.

Lock Type

The type of lock dictates the size you need for your U-Haul vehicle. There are many types of locks available in the market, including padlocks, combination locks, and deadbolts. Each of these locks has a specific size requirement. U-Haul offers locks that fit each moving truck size or trailer they rent out.

Trailer or Moving Truck Size

The size of the vehicle is a crucial determinant when selecting the right lock size. This option is necessary since different truck or trailer sizes come equipped with different door sizes, so the lock size you choose should match their door size. Ensure you know the door size of the moving truck or trailer you are renting out before selecting a specific lock size.

The Standard U-Haul Lock Size

standard uhaul lock size

U-Haul has a standard size that is recommended for all rental trucks and trailers. The standard U-Haul lock size is 2 and ¾ inches and has a shackle diameter of 7/16 inches.

This lock size is suitable for most U-Haul trucks and trailers, including cargo vans, pickup trucks, and small trailers. However, if you are renting a larger truck or trailer, you may need to choose a different lock size.
